Review

The experiences shared by families regarding their loved ones at Darcy Hall in West Palm Beach reveal a complex tapestry of care, frustration, and some commendable moments amid chaos. The overarching theme that emerges from these reviews is the significant disparity in the quality of care provided, as well as systemic issues within communication channels among staff members at all levels.

One family expressed profound frustration with the lack of communication between various departments and personnel at the facility. Their sister had been experiencing severe hip and back pain but was placed on steroids upon admission without adequate follow-up or discussion about this treatment. This oversight led to her gaining an alarming 60 pounds while waiting for necessary medical interventions. They recounted the unfortunate circumstance where the doctor “forgot” about prescribing steroids, leading to insufficient coordination in managing her treatment plan. With degenerative arthritis and a fracture worsening over time, a timely hip replacement became crucial—yet this urgent need could have been mitigated with clearer communication across teams.

In stark contrast, another reviewer praised Darcy Hall for providing excellent care since their loved one’s arrival in February 2020. They highlighted how dedicated the staff—ranging from administration to healthcare providers—has been during exceptionally challenging times. This perspective underscores that while some families express frustration, others find reassurance knowing their relatives are attended to competently and compassionately. However, it is evident that such positive experiences may not be universal within the facility.

On the other hand, a concerning account emerged from another family's unfortunate experience when their mother arrived at Darcy Hall without proper accommodations for mobility. She fell shortly after her admission and subsequently broke her hip two days later due to what they perceived as inadequate safety measures being implemented by staff members. Despite assurances regarding safety protocols like floor pads and low beds, these measures failed to prevent incidents that culminated in her needing partial hip replacement surgery on Christmas Day. The family described their dissatisfaction with the attentiveness of caregivers; they felt they lacked urgency and vigilance required in such settings where patients can be vulnerable.

Conversely, another review shed light on a more favorable experience with structured activities catered towards residents’ needs—aspects like bus trips were mentioned positively alongside adequate food quality. This review underscored that despite some challenges noted about staffing attentiveness elsewhere, there were numerous engaging options available for residents looking to maintain an active lifestyle within rehabilitation frameworks.

With yet another insightful review from a concerned child seeking rehab placement for their mother reiterated how responsive both therapy and nursing staff can be when handling patients who may present unique challenges. Living out of state heightened concerns about continuity of care; however, this reviewer felt assured through effective communication regarding their mother's care plan with an openness to address specific needs—a marked difference compared to other accounts which cited disorganization and neglect.

Ultimately, what emerges from these narratives is an urgent call for systemic reform at Darcy Hall surrounding organizational communication practices. Families understandably seek comfort knowing their loved ones receive competent healthcare support; however, disparities highlighted indicate areas requiring immediate attention—from operational structure to enhanced caregiver training focused on sensitivity toward patient needs—to ensure every resident receives optimal care befitting their dignity and health necessities.
